资源说明:2、递归输出
【问题描述】
给定一个整数n,1≤n≤20,要求设计一个递归算法,实现下面两种方式(下三角和上三角)的文件输出。
n n n ... n 1
…… 2 2
3 3 3 3 3 3
2 2 ……
1 n n n … n
要求:输出形式可用户选择;数字之间采用TAB键隔开(使用’\t’)。
【输入数据】
输入数据由3.txt给出,文件格式为:第一行是一个整数n;第二行是一个整数,表示输出方式,取值0/1分别表示下三角/上三角。
【输出数据】
输出数据由4.txt给出,按照上述格式输出到文件中。
【实现提示】
本题是对递归算法的初步考察,了解递归函数的三个执行特点:
(1)函数名相同;
(2)不断地自调用;
(3)最后被调用的函数,要最先被返回。
4
本源码包内暂不包含可直接显示的源代码文件,请下载源码包。
-
- Bayer.rar基于Bayer彩色滤波阵列插值算法的研究,原本为收费文档。
- BCMATH.rar// 《用C++语言编写数学常用算法(修订版)》Borland C++程序的源代码 ...
- java.rarpublic class BubbleSort{ static String printArray(int[] a){ String result="" ...
- asdf.rar用C语言编写的程序,多维数组按列相加,可以得到必要的结果
- TRIAN_REPLACE.rar列火车要将n节车厢分别送往n个车站车站按1~n的次序编号,火车按照n, n-1,…, 1的编号 ...
- lx.rar背包问题,回溯算法,用VB描述的材料,源程序十分详细
- 1.rar一本对ACM国际大学生程序设计竞赛试题与解析,深入浅出
- kalman_filter.rar可以实现kalman滤波的c++代码,函数部分采取了简化处理,输入不一改动昂 ...
- 895.rarn个野人n个传教士过河问题的代码,文件输出结果
- acm1.rarabove average acm大赛题目。有待改进。
-
- 货郎担问题源代码.rar货郎担问题源代码 货郎担问题源代码
- leda.tar.gz高效数据类型和算法库,含很多数值算法
- bplus.zip一个简单好用的B+树算法实现
- SVM--SVM.rar支持向量机,用于分类,含训练集与测试集。里面含有六个源程序 ...
- hash.zip哈希表实现
- work.rar本程序是基于机动目标跟踪课题的整个算法程序,其中包括卡尔曼,扩展卡尔曼和粒子滤波 ...
- btree2.zip用C++实现的B-Tree算法
- C++常用算法之06矩阵特征值与特征向量的计算.rar本代码是《计算机常用数值计算算法与程序 C++版》一书的配套矩阵特征值与特征向量的计 ...
- diancichangyudiancibo.rar电磁场与电磁波 高等教育出版社 谢处方编答案
- VIS.zip该源码是关于运动对象跟踪的算法,主要实现了高斯背景建模,全局运动补偿(SIFT特征和 ...